An 11-year-old boy crashed a pickup truck into a gaggle of monks on a pilgrimage stroll in northeastern Thailand on Thursday, killing 9 and injuring 13 others, officers mentioned.
A complete of 35 monks from Mukdahan province, about 600 kilometers northeast of the capital Bangkok, have been on the pilgrimage. 5 monks have been killed on the web site, whereas three others died at a hospital, in keeping with Mukdahan Governor Worrayan Boonnarat. The workplace later introduced the dying of a ninth monk.
13 have been hospitalized with three in vital situation, in keeping with the provincial administration.
The group began the 260-kilometer stroll to Ubon Ratchathani province about half-hour earlier than the crash.
Safety digital camera footage shared by a neighborhood rescue group, Ruam Jai Mukdahan Rescue Affiliation, exhibits the monks strolling in a single line on the facet of a highway earlier than the truck crashes into them.
Native police mentioned the boy is now in custody and shall be questioned when state youngster safety officers arrive.
The police mentioned the reason for the accident remains to be below investigation, however mentioned they have been instructed by the monks that they noticed the automobile swerving earlier than it slid off the highway and crashed into the group.

“I noticed a boy driving a pickup truck, approaching. At that second I used to be chanting ‘Buddho, Buddho’ (a meditation mantra),” one monk, recognized as Phra Sompong, mentioned in a video posted on-line by native rescue employees.
“Then instantly the truck hit at full velocity and crashed us like this,” he mentioned, gesticulating.
“Fortunately one other monk and I managed to leap out of the way in which in time,” he added.
“The primary 9 monks in line survived. However others who have been hit have been thrown into the air.”

CCTV footage from a close-by property exhibits the monks strolling alongside the highway, a number of autos driving previous after which the sound of a loud crash earlier than the procession stops.
Police mentioned the boy had taken his mother and father’ pickup truck with out permission earlier than shedding management of the automobile and crashing into the monks.
“The suspect is a baby. The automobile has been taken for forensic examination to find out the trigger,” Police Main Basic Pairoj Thaiphutsa, commander of the Mukdahan Provincial Police, instructed reporters.
“We have requested the kid’s mother and father to return in so we are able to decide who’s chargeable for the kid’s care, so we are able to go on with authorized course of,” he added.
Prayut Ruanthongkam, chief of Mukdahan Metropolis Police, instructed AFP by phone that the kid was a boy aged 11.
Buddhist monks are extremely honored in Thailand, entrusted with preserving and passing on the Buddha’s teachings.
They usually maintain public processions and are extensively seen receiving alms of goodwill from peculiar Thais.
Mukdahan provincial governor Worayan Bunnarat mentioned the case ought to function a wider warning on highway security.
Lethal transport accidents are frequent in Thailand, which has one of many worst highway security information on the planet, with dashing, drunk driving and weak legislation enforcement all contributing components.
“We have been very strict on highway security in recent times. This case needs to be a lesson not only for our province, however for the general public typically on the subject of stopping highway accidents,” he mentioned.
“I feel everybody concerned, particularly mother and father, wants to assist, as a result of nobody desires one thing like this to occur.”
